摘要:
PROBLEM TO BE SOLVED: To provide a light-transmissive organic electroluminescent element, a luminaire and a method for manufacturing an organic electroluminescent element.SOLUTION: According to an embodiment, there is provided an organic electroluminescent element that includes a first electrode, a plurality of second electrodes and an organic light-emitting layer. The first electrode has a first principal surface. The first electrode has light-transmitting property. The plurality of second electrodes are opposite to the first electrode, extend along a first direction parallel to the first principal surface, and are spaced apart from each other in a second direction parallel to the first principal surface and perpendicular to the first direction. The light transmittance of the second electrodes is lower than the light transmittance of the first electrode. Side surfaces of the second electrodes are fluctuated in a wave shape along the first direction. The organic light-emitting layer is disposed between the first electrode and the second electrodes.
摘要(中):
要解决的问题:提供一种透光性有机电致发光元件,照明装置和有机电致发光元件的制造方法。解决方案:根据实施方式,提供一种有机电致发光元件,其包括第一电极,多个 第二电极和有机发光层。 第一电极具有第一主表面。 第一电极具有透光性。 多个第二电极与第一电极相对,沿着平行于第一主表面的第一方向延伸,并且在平行于第一主表面并垂直于第一方向的第二方向上彼此间隔开。 第二电极的透光率低于第一电极的透光率。 第二电极的侧面沿第一方向波动。 有机发光层设置在第一电极和第二电极之间。
